The Lunch Hour: A Passionate Ritual

Every match at the Estadio de la Cerámica begins long before the referee's whistle. For Villarreal CF fans, the lunch hour has become a ritual filled with tradition and camaraderie. Supporters, known for their appreciation of good food and great company, gather in nearby bars and restaurants, creating a vibrant atmosphere that can be felt throughout the city.

Local gastronomy plays a crucial role in this experience. Traditional dishes from the region, such as paella and a variety of tapas, are served alongside local beers and wines, allowing fans to enjoy a lunch that is both a feast and a celebration. This moment of gathering not only nourishes the body but also the spirit, as fans share stories, anecdotes, and predictions about the upcoming match.

Connection with Valencia CF

When the rival is Valencia CF, the atmosphere intensifies. The rivalry between the two teams is palpable, reflected in animated conversations and a festive ambiance. The geographical proximity between Villarreal and Valencia adds a level of excitement that transforms the pre-match experience into a near-festive event. The chants echoing in the bars testify to the fervor felt by the fans, creating a sense of unity and belonging that is hard to match.
